StepDescription
1Notify all stakeholders about the maintenance schedule and expected downtime.
2Implement temporary request handling mechanisms to prevent data loss or leakage during maintenance.
3Engage a secure backup system to store transaction data in case of any unforeseen circumstances.
4Run thorough security checks before initiating the maintenance process.
5Apply necessary security patches and updates to ensure a secure environment.
6Disable unnecessary services or APIs temporarily to reduce attack vectors.
7Implement proper access controls and permissions for the maintenance team.
8Monitor the system continuously during maintenance to detect any security breaches.
9Perform regular backups of the system and data to ensure quick recovery if needed.
10Conduct post-maintenance security audits to identify and remedy any vulnerabilities.

Common Security Threats for Payment Gateway APIs

Payment gateway APIs are prone to various security threats.

Some common threats include:

  • Brute Force Attacks: Hackers try multiple login attempts to gain unauthorized access to the API by guessing the username and password combinations.
  • Cross-Site Scripting (XSS Attacks: Attackers inject malicious code into the API, which then gets executed in the user’s browser, compromising sensitive information.
  • SQL Injection Attacks: Malicious users input SQL commands into API parameters, leading to unauthorized access, data theft, or manipulation.
  • Denial of Service (DoS Attacks: Attackers overwhelm the API with a flood of requests, causing it to crash or become unresponsive, disrupting services for legitimate users.
  • Man-in-the-Middle (MitM Attacks: Hackers intercept the communication between the payment gateway and the user, allowing them to tamper with or steal sensitive data.
  • Insufficient Authorization and Access Control: Inadequate validation of user permissions and access control mechanisms can give unauthorized individuals access to sensitive functionality or data.
  • Insecure Direct Object References: If APIs expose direct database references, attackers can use them to manipulate or access unauthorized data.

To protect payment gateway APIs, it’s crucial to implement strong authentication, input validation, and encryption mechanisms, regularly update software, and conduct security audits.

Implement Strong Authentication and Authorization Mechanisms

To implement strong authentication and authorization mechanisms for payment gateway APIs, there are a few key steps you should take. Firstly, ensure that only authorized users have access to the APIs by implementing multi-factor authentication, such as using passwords and verification codes.

Secondly, use role-based access control to grant different levels of permissions to different users.

Thirdly, regularly monitor and log API access to detect any suspicious activity. Overall, these measures will help protect the security and integrity of your payment gateway APIs during maintenance.

Implement Load Balancing for Redundancy

To ensure high availability during maintenance, implementing load balancing for redundancy is essential. Load balancing distributes incoming traffic across multiple servers, preventing any single server from becoming overwhelmed.

This redundancy ensures that even if one server goes down for maintenance, others will continue to handle requests, minimizing downtime and maintaining a seamless experience for users.

It’s a crucial strategy for maintaining reliability and availability during maintenance periods.

Use Failover Systems to Minimize Downtime

Failover systems are essential for minimizing downtime in payment gateway APIs during maintenance. These systems provide redundancy by automatically switching to a backup server if the primary server fails.

This ensures uninterrupted service for customers and minimizes the impact of maintenance on the availability of payment gateway APIs.

What encryption methods should be used for securing payment gateway APIs?

To ensure the security of payment gateway APIs, it is important to use strong encryption methods. This includes implementing the use of SSL/TLS protocols, which encrypt data during transit.

Additionally, utilizing encryption algorithms such as AES (Advanced Encryption Standard) or RSA (Rivest-Shamir-Adleman) can further enhance the security of the payment gateway APIs. It is crucial to regularly update and patch these encryption methods to stay ahead of potential vulnerabilities.
